turn something in

Related to word: turn

片語動詞

Definition (achieve)

  1. to achieve outcomes, typically beneficial ones

    • The company turned in a substantial profit last year.

    • If you work hard, you will surely turn in good results.

    • This strategy helped us turn in a considerable return to investors this year.

Definition (submit)

  1. to submit something to an organization or someone in a position of authority

    • Students are required to turn in their assignments before the deadline.

    • He turned in the report to the manager this morning.

    • She plans to turn in the library books by Friday.
